From small home improvements to major infrastructure schemes, aggregates are the foundation of successful construction. Designed to deliver strength, stability and performance, they support projects of every size with consistent, reliable results.
For residential builds, aggregates create solid bases for driveways, patios and pathways, while enhancing garden landscaping with practical drainage and long‑lasting structure. They underpin house foundations and drainage installations, ensuring homes are built on dependable ground that stands the test of time.
In commercial construction, aggregates provide the durability demanded by high‑traffic environments. Retail developments, offices, car parks, schools and hospitals all rely on robust sub‑bases and effective water management solutions. Aggregates also shape hard‑landscaping and public realm projects, delivering smart, resilient surfaces built for daily use.
For civil engineering and infrastructure, aggregates are essential to large‑scale performance. They drive earthworks and ground stabilisation, reinforce embankments and support drainage and utility installations. From highways and access roads to rail networks, service corridors and major public projects, aggregates form the backbone of long‑term, high‑spec construction.
